Superclogger
Superclogger

Every Friday of the summer of 2010, this project engaged the most grid-locked of commuters on the freeways of greater Los Angeles. Four separate plays were accompanied by synched soundtracks that were presented over an FM audio broadcast to the surrounding cars. (A cardboard sign was lowered onto the tailgate to instruct them of the broadcasting FM band – not pictured).
